Very true...There are indeed two lagoses or even three as it were...There is Lagos,Lagoss and their is lagos and then Lagoss.... Breakdown as shown below; Lagos...Ikoyi, Victoria Island,Lekki and environs Lagoss...Ajah and it environs all through to Epe. lagos.... Obalende,Idumota,Adeniji Adele and entire Lagos Island. lagosss...entire mainland.... The truth is the federal government has a major role to play in this case..if they can set up more infrastructure and industries in other states then spread across the nation it would help in reducing the large inflow of people into the same... I sometime in 2009 did a research work with the community development approach towards poverty alleviation and I was able to understand that most people move from the rural to the urban in search of better life and other benefits as they are not made available in the City they are original from... everything is Lagos and I pray it doesn't burst as it is cos if it does...it would have a massive effect on a lot of things..
